“…1,2 Concerning causes of periorbital petechiae include seizures and strangulation. 2,3 It is also import ant to consider the possibility of interpersonal violence as a cause of facial petechiae. A detailed medical and social history, along with physical examination, can help determine subsequent investigations.…”
